Verloren Village lurks behind a veil of mist & forests, with tight-knit buildings and a community that is anything but. It includes adventure hooks for a recent spate of kidnapped children and a resulting curfew but you can just as easily make use of the town for your own quests.
It includes three pre-walled and lit maps from Chibbin Grove that show each floor of the town, two playlists from Ivan Duch containing 12 music tracks and four loopable ambient audio files, four poster handouts from Of Metal and Magic that set up potential new quest lines, and 4 tokens from Kevs Lounge along with two more from Paper Mage to fill out the town.

To install this package, open your Foundry Setup screen and navigate to your Module tab and click the Install Module button.
From there, you can either search for the package unique name: verloren-village or copy its manifest URL:
And paste it to the input box at the bottom of your window.
